Two charged over fraud involving state-funded milk supplies for Georgian kindergartens

The Georgian Prosecutor’s Office has filed charges against two individuals for embezzling a large sum of money through abuse of official position.

The Ministry of Finance’s Investigative Service on Friday said the heads of several companies had supplied low-calorie, low-cost dairy products to municipal pre-school and non-school educational institutions in violation of the terms of state procurement contracts. The Prosecutor’s Office said this allowed the accused to fraudulently obtain approximately 20,000 Georgian lari belonging to the state.

The two are charged under Article 180(2)(b) and (3)(a) and (b) of the Georgian Criminal Code, covering fraud committed through abuse of official position with a large amount of money. Conviction under these provisions carries a sentence of up to nine years in prison.

The Prosecutor’s Office added that it will request the court to apply preventive measures against the accused within the timeframe prescribed by law.
